What "zero defect" actually means
YirgZ isn't just Grade 1. It's coffee that's been sorted beyond standard grading requirements. Here's the difference:
Standard Grade 1
Up to 3 full defects allowed per 300g sample. Some quakers, some insect damage—acceptable within spec.
YirgZ Zero Defect
Additional hand-sorting after export milling. We pull the defects that Grade 1 allows. The cup has to be clean.

The Process
How YirgZ quality happens
Source selection
We buy from YCFCU—the Yirgacheffe Coffee Farmers Cooperative Union. 20+ year relationship. They know our standards.
Origin cupping
Sam cups at origin before we commit. Looking for: citrus clarity, floral notes, clean finish. No compromises.
Additional sorting
After standard export milling, we request additional hand-sorting. Pull the quakers. Pull the insect damage. Get to zero.
Arrival verification
Every YirgZ lot gets re-cupped in Baltimore. Arrival sample must match origin sample. If it doesn't, we investigate.
Trademark protection
YirgZ is our trademark. Only coffee that meets our standard gets the name. Our reputation is on the line with every bag.
Climate-controlled storage
Washed coffees need proper storage too. Consistent temperature and humidity preserve the brightness you're paying for.
